139° 10′ This is degree minutes. Convert the minutes to decimal by dividing the minutes by 60.
10/60 = 0.167
So 139° 10′ = 139.167 degrees.
Now convert to radians:
139.167 x pi/180 = 2.429 radians
The answer may be slightly different depending on the rounding of everything.
